Apodiformes Adventures
4.5/5 – 238 Reviews
Best price guarantee
Your request will be sent directly to the operator
If preferred, you can contact the operator directly
$9,099 to $12,299 pp (USD)
$7,424 to $8,956 pp (USD)
$4,699 to $6,099 pp (USD)